Output 183534f4b89275820ba5933db7152da3961c75340eb631a259e5982269eef7f3:0

value
6520528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c15050bf1332c9d3f491c5a281f29cdcc9a1fca OP_EQUALVERIFY OP_CHECKSIG
address
17wHY4A2dSinC3qdSJZtzucQqdDhFdQpxk
transaction
183534f4b89275820ba5933db7152da3961c75340eb631a259e5982269eef7f3
spent
true